Problem
Current traffic management systems face challenges in predicting and mitigating traffic congestion, ensuring traffic safety, and securing communication protocols between traffic signals and vehicles, particularly due to human delays, distractions, and vulnerabilities in communication protocols that can lead to collisions and unauthorized access.
Innovation Solution
A localized data collection module (LDCM) is installed in or adjacent to traffic control cabinets to collect data from various traffic hardware devices, aggregate and transmit it to remote locations, and implement security protocols, enabling real-time traffic monitoring, alert generation, and secure communication between traffic signals and vehicles.

A system and method for collecting, processing, storing, or transmitting traffic data. A localized data collection module may retrieve, receive, or intercept traffic data through or from hardware installed in a traffic control cabinet adjacent an intersection or other roadway feature of interest. Data which may have previously been confined to a closed loop traffic control system may be remotely accessible for traffic operations control or monitoring via a network connected server and/or cloud architecture.
